5-56 SCPI Command Reference
Questionable Event Register:
Bits B0 through B3 — Not used.
Bit B4, Temperature Summary (Temp) — Set bit indicates that an invalid
reference junction measurement has occurred for thermocouple temperature
measurements.
Bits B5 through B7 — Not used.
Bit B8, Calibration Summary (Cal) — Set bit indicates that an invalid
calibration constant was detected during the power-up sequence. The
instrument will instead use a default calibration constant. This error will clear
after successful calibration of the instrument.
Bits B9 through B13 — Not used.
Bit B14, Command Warning (Warn) — Set bit indicates that a Signal
Oriented Measurement Command parameter has been ignored.
NOTE Whenever a questionable event occurs, the ERR annunciator will
turn on. The annunciator will turn off when the questionable event
clears.
